Donkey Kong Country Returns HD Demo Now Available on Switch

Nintendo has released a demo for Donkey Kong Country Returns HD on the Nintendo Switch via the eShop. The full game, which launched on January 16, 2025, is a high-definition update of the original Wii title, featuring enhanced visuals and additional content.

In this adventure, Donkey Kong and Diddy Kong set out to reclaim their stolen banana hoard from the mischievous Tiki Tak Tribe. Players can navigate through 80 levels across nine diverse worlds, including content from the Nintendo 3DS version. The game offers both solo and two-player local cooperative modes, allowing friends to team up and tackle challenges together.

The gameplay involves classic platforming elements such as stomping enemies, blasting through barrels, and riding vehicles like mine carts and rockets. Players can also ride Rambi the Rhino to smash through obstacles. The game introduces various moves, including the Ground Pound, Roll, Blow, and Grab and Cling, to overcome obstacles and defeat enemies.

For those who prefer a more relaxed experience, the game offers an option to reduce difficulty, providing extra hearts and other aids to make the journey smoother. This feature makes the game accessible to a wider audience, ensuring that both newcomers and veterans can enjoy the adventure.

Since its release, Donkey Kong Country Returns HD has seen significant success, with over 107,000 retail copies sold in Japan during its opening week.
